Who are we?
HTBA is a science-based global leader in the manufacturing and commercialization of citrus flavonoids and active forms of vitamin B12 for the nutraceutical, pharmaceutical, food and beverage, and animal nutrition sectors. For over forty-five years, the company has pioneered the development of new processes to create high-quality, naturally derived ingredients that support the health of people and animals, all while protecting the environment.
Headquartered in Barcelona, HTBA produces ingredients of unsurpassed quality at its state-of-the-art manufacturing facility in Murcia, Spain. Plus, with ideation centers located in Spain and at its North American operations center in Ohio, the company is well-positioned to understand and quickly respond to global end-user consumer demand.
Today, HTBA delivers cutting-edge products to more than 60 countries worldwide in line with its mission to unlock the power of nature and have a measurable impact on well-being.
